Jackson slowly let go of Rosalyn, who did not react at all. His heart completely sank when he saw the offish and disgust in her eyes.

“Rosalyn, you’ll regret it…”

After saying that, Jackson turned around and supported himself against the wall. He staggered away.

Looking at his back, which was highly hurt, Rosalyn felt a lump in her throat and burst into tears.

Seeing Rosalyn like this, Eva was a little puzzled. “You obviously can’t bear to part with Jackson. Why did you do this to him?”

“Rosalyn, are you still blaming him for kicking you twice…”

Rosalyn shook her head. “I don’t blame him anymore. He didn’t do it.”

This time, without waiting for Eva to ask, Rosalyn told Eva that Jackson had a twin brother.

Eva instantly relaxed. Her hatred for Jackson had dissipated a lot.

It turned out that Jackson hadn’t been ruthless to Rosalyn. It was true that Ryan had lost his memory and then become Jackson. He hadn’t lied to them.

Rosalyn’s love for Ryan had not been in vain, but….

Eva’s love for Ryan had not been in vain, but…

There was a deep look of confusion in Eva’s eyes. “Then why did you do this to him…”

Rosalyn took a deep breath and was about to tell Eva about her late-stage heart failure when Eva’s phone rang.

“Rosalyn, wait a minute. Daniel is calling. I’ll answer the phone first.”

Rosalyn had no choice but to shut up. When she saw Eva’s bitter expression after hanging up the phone, she asked worriedly, “What happened?”

“Daniel said that something happened at his parent’s home, and he was in a hurry to return to his hometown.” Eva had never hidden anything from Rosalyn, so she told Rosalyn everything, honestly. “Then don’t stay here with me. Hurry up and go back with Daniel to take a look,” said Rosalyn.

Not only was Eva not in a hurry to leave, but she also sat down beside Rosalyn’s bed.

“Daniel said that his family owed others some debts. He’ll pay them back as soon as he gets back. I don’t have to go with him.”

“I’m afraid Daniel doesn’t want to take Eva home,” thought Rosalyn.

Rosalyn looked at Eva peeling oranges by the bed. She wanted to say something but didn’t know where to start.

Now that Eva and Daniel were married, no matter what she said, she feared it would affect their relationship.

After peeling the orange, Eva looked at Rosalyn, who wanted to say something but stopped on second thought. She smiled at Rosalyn and said, “I know what you’re worried about. Don’t be afraid. I’ll handle it myself. Daniel doesn’t want me to go back to his hometown. It’s no big deal…”

Eva looked indifferent. She handed the peeled orange to Rosalyn and said, “Come on, have some oranges and supplement some vitamins.”

Rosalyn took the orange, put it in her mouth, and chewed it, but she had no appetite.

Her stomach felt sour when she swallowed it, and she almost threw up.

Frightened that Eva would be worried, she endured it.

Eva was probably in a low mood and didn’t notice anything wrong with Rosalyn. She just lowered her head and peeled an apple. Eva gave the peeled apple to Rosalyn. Rosalyn didn’t eat it this time and put it on the bedside table.

“Eva, did Daniel tell you how many debts his family owes?”

“Yes.”

Eva nodded. After a pause, she told Rosalyn how much money they owed.

“Two hundred thousand.”

His family owed 200,000 dollars in debt, but Daniel only told Eva about it and hurried back to pay it off. He didn’t even discuss it with Eva.

“He took his own money, not mine…”

Eva feared Rosalyn would be worried, so she added another sentence, which sounded a little ironic.

The mortgage of the house Daniel bought was paid for by Eva, however, the so-called husband didn’t let her control the purse strings.

If Rosalyn knew that the money Eva earned after getting married was used to pay off the mortgage and cover their daily expenses, she would probably be angrier.

Eva didn’t tell Rosalyn what had happened after she married Daniel. She feared Rosalyn would worry her, so Eva didn’t dare to say to her.

Seeing that Rosalyn was angry, Eva had no choice but to say, “After I married Daniel, he did change a little. Of course, he’s still as good to me as before, but he has something wrong. I don’t know how to describe it…”

s s Daniel’s kindness to her was not only tenderness and sweetness but also seeping into her life bit by bit. No matter how hard and tiring his work was, he would clean up the house and prevent her from cooking or washing clothes when he returned home from a business trip. It could be said that he treated her meticulously. Eva lacked love. When she met someone who cared for her like this, she naturally handed over her heart and relied heavily on him.

Although Daniel still treated her like when she was in love after they got married, he always found some excuses in front of her for financial things. He complained about being poor in front of Eva. Eva was a soft-hearted person. She took the initiative to repay the mortgage because Daniel didn’t have enough money. Daniel recently said that his sales had not improved and he didn’t get a bonus. There were still sickly older people in his family he wanted to support, so Eva also had to pay for their living expenses.

Now there were 200,000 dollars in debt in their family. Although Daniel said he would pay it back himself, the 200,000 dollars belonged to their joint property.

After getting married, Eva put all the money and some that Daniel had given her into a card. She wanted to deposit some baby funds for their future children. Daniel said that his basic salary would also be transferred to that card.

But it didn’t take long for 200,000 dollars to be deducted directly.

When they married, the betrothal gifts they gave Eva were 180,000 dollars. With his little money, it was precisely 200,000 dollars…

Eva didn’t want to guess what Daniel was thinking about after they had dated for so many years. Money was unimportant to her, and his love was the most important. But such a thing happened as soon as they married, making her a little unhappy.

“Why didn’t you tell me earlier?” complained Rosalyn.

If she knew that Daniel asked Eva to pay off all the mortgage and daily expenses after they married, she would remind Eva. At least she wouldn’t let Eva take out all her private savings after marriage. Although Daniel and Eva had been in a relationship for many years. Eva needed to leave a way out for herself. But Eva was even stupider than her. Eva put all her money in a card. What should Eva do if something goes wrong between them in the future?

Fortunately, Rosalyn had left more than 200,000 dollars for Eva, but it was a drop in the bucket for her long life.

Seeing Rosalyn let out a long sigh, Eva didn’t feel aggrieved but comforted her with a smile. “Don’t worry. It’s just a little money. I’ll get them after selling a few more bottles of wine.” How could Rosalyn not be worried about her? Rosalyn knew how much money Eva had earned over the years.

It was all thanks to the tips that she earned from drinking with customers. She slowly saved it up bit by bit.

Although she had become the manager recently and didn’t have to drink anymore, she still had to stay up late to earn money.

Rosalyn was afraid that Eva wouldn’t be able to take it, but Eva didn’t care about it at all.

“What you should be most concerned about now is the relationship between you, Jackson, and Andrew, not me.”

“I’ve broken up with both of them. Now, you’re the only one left by my side. Of course, I only care about you.”
